Cognitive Biases and Decision Making in Gambling - Mariano ... Heuristics and cognitive biases can occur in reasoning and decision making. Some of them are very common in gamblers (illusion of control, representativeness, availability, etc.). Structural characteristics and functioning of games of chance favor the appearance of these biases. Two experiments were conducted with nonpathological gamblers. The first experiment was a game of dice with wagers. Cognitive Psychopathology of Problem Gambling COGNITIVE PSYCHOPATHOLOGY OF PROBLEM GAMBLING 1595 ing losses, predicting pay outs). Regular slot machine players were more likely to report beliefs that skill was as important as chance in determining outcomes and judged themselves to possess above average skill at playing slot machines than did nonregular players.
